Lexus Capital Forex Broker - Complete Information Guide

  

1. Broker Overview

  Lexus Capital is a forex broker that was established in 2024. The company is headquartered in Isleworth, Middlesex, United Kingdom. As a private entity, Lexus Capital primarily focuses on offering trading services in the forex and cryptocurrency markets. Over the past few years, it has aimed to cater to a diverse clientele, including retail traders and investors looking for opportunities in these dynamic markets.

  Despite its recent inception, Lexus Capital has faced significant challenges, particularly regarding its regulatory status. The broker operates without any valid regulatory licenses, which raises concerns about its legitimacy and operational practices. The lack of regulatory oversight is a critical factor for potential clients to consider, as it may impact the safety of their investments.

  In terms of its business model, Lexus Capital is primarily engaged in retail forex trading. It positions itself as a platform for individual traders to access the forex market, although specific details regarding its trading conditions and offerings remain unclear. The company's website has been reported as inaccessible, further complicating its operational transparency.

  

2. Regulatory and Compliance Information

  Lexus Capital operates in a highly unregulated environment, which poses substantial risks for its clients. Currently, there are no known regulatory authorities overseeing the broker. This absence of regulation is confirmed by various sources, indicating that Lexus Capital lacks the necessary licenses to operate legally within the financial markets.

  The company has been blacklisted by the Spanish financial authority (CNMV), which has raised significant red flags regarding its operations. The lack of a regulatory framework means that clients have no recourse in case of disputes or issues related to their investments.

  In terms of compliance measures, Lexus Capital does not provide clear information about its Know Your Customer (KYC) and Anti-Money Laundering (AML) policies. This lack of transparency is concerning, as reputable brokers typically implement strict KYC and AML protocols to protect their clients and the integrity of the financial system.

  

3. Trading Products and Services

  Lexus Capital offers a limited range of trading products, primarily focusing on forex and cryptocurrencies. The broker does not provide access to other asset classes such as commodities, indices, stocks, or ETFs, which may limit trading opportunities for clients seeking diversification.

  The forex offerings include a selection of major currency pairs, although the exact number of pairs available for trading is not specified. In terms of cryptocurrencies, Lexus Capital provides access to some of the most popular digital currencies, catering to the growing demand for crypto trading.

  The broker has also outlined several investment plans, including options for novice traders and more experienced investors, with varying minimum deposit requirements and promised returns. However, the specifics of these plans, including details on spreads and leverage, remain vague.

  Lexus Capital does not provide any proprietary trading tools or platforms, which may hinder traders looking for advanced trading features. The absence of a demo account further complicates the situation, as potential clients cannot test the platform before committing real funds.

  

4. Trading Platforms and Technology

  Lexus Capital does not support well-known trading platforms such as MetaTrader 4 or MetaTrader 5. Instead, it appears to rely on a proprietary web-based trading platform, though specific details about its functionality and features are not provided. The lack of information regarding the trading platform raises concerns about its reliability and user-friendliness.

  The broker does not offer a mobile trading application, which is a significant drawback for traders who prefer to manage their accounts on-the-go. Additionally, there is no mention of API access or support for automated trading, which may deter algorithmic traders from considering this broker.

  In terms of execution models, there is no clear information available regarding whether Lexus Capital operates on an ECN, STP, or Market Making basis. This ambiguity can lead to uncertainty regarding the broker's pricing and execution quality.

  Overall, the technological infrastructure of Lexus Capital appears to be lacking, which could impact the trading experience for its clients.

  

5. Account Types and Trading Conditions

  Lexus Capital offers a limited range of account types, primarily designed to cater to different levels of traders. The minimum deposit requirement is set at $200, which is relatively accessible for novice traders. However, the broker does not provide clear information on the spreads and commissions associated with its accounts, making it difficult for potential clients to assess the cost of trading.

  There are several investment plans available, including options for novice and more experienced traders. These plans promise varying returns based on the initial investment, but the specifics regarding leverage and trading conditions remain unclear.

  The broker does not offer a demo account, which is a significant disadvantage for traders looking to practice their strategies before committing real funds. Additionally, there is no mention of specialized accounts such as Islamic accounts or corporate accounts, which may limit its appeal to a broader audience.

  The minimum trade size and overnight fees are also not disclosed, further contributing to the lack of transparency regarding trading conditions.

  

6. Fund Management

  Lexus Capital supports a limited selection of deposit methods, including bank transfers and credit cards. However, specific details regarding the processing times and fees for deposits are not provided, which could create uncertainty for clients looking to fund their accounts.

  The minimum deposit requirements vary depending on the account type, but the overall requirement is set at $200. This relatively low threshold may attract novice traders, but the lack of detailed information regarding deposit processing times and fees is concerning.

  Withdrawal methods are not clearly outlined, which raises questions about the broker's ability to facilitate timely and efficient withdrawals. The absence of information regarding withdrawal processing times and associated fees further complicates the situation, leaving potential clients unsure about the ease of accessing their funds.

  Overall, the lack of transparency regarding fund management practices is a significant drawback for Lexus Capital.

  

7. Customer Support and Educational Resources

  Lexus Capital provides limited customer support options, primarily through email communication. However, the lack of accessible contact methods, such as live chat or phone support, may hinder clients from receiving timely assistance.

  The service hours and time zone coverage are not specified, which could lead to difficulties for clients in different regions seeking support. Additionally, there is no mention of multilingual support, which may limit accessibility for non-English speaking clients.

  In terms of educational resources, Lexus Capital does not appear to offer comprehensive training materials or tools for its clients. The absence of webinars, tutorials, or market analysis services indicates a lack of commitment to client education and support.

  Overall, the customer support and educational offerings of Lexus Capital are minimal, which may deter potential clients from engaging with the broker.

  

8. Regional Coverage and Restrictions

  Lexus Capital primarily serves clients in the United Kingdom, but specific details regarding its overall market presence are not disclosed. The broker does not provide information about regional offices or the extent of its international operations.

  There are no clear indications of countries or regions from which clients are excluded, but the lack of regulatory oversight may limit its appeal in certain jurisdictions. Potential clients should be aware that the absence of regulation could pose risks when trading with Lexus Capital.
